Insure vs. Ensure vs. Assure: What’s the Difference? In general senses, ensure and insure are interchanged, but this financial sense is what distinguishes insure today We primarily use insure to talk about providing or obtaining insurance, as in After all his car accidents, the company refuses to insure him again
Insure vs. Ensure vs. Assure - Merriam-Webster Even though they can be synonyms, one way to make sure of correct usage is to use 'insure' to relate to financial matters and 'ensure' in the broader meaning of making certain or safe

How to use Assure vs. Ensure vs. Insure | Grammarly Assure vs ensure vs insure: What’s the difference? The word assure means to tell someone something something positive to remove their doubts The word ensure means to make certain of something The word insure means to buy insurance coverage
